The Associated Press reports the Raiders will fire coach Dennis Allen.
Reporter Terry Collins is not a typical Rotoworld source, but the AP has stringent standards. Per Collins, an announcement may not be made until Tuesday. It would be bizarre for a team to go two days between deciding to fire a coach and announcing it, but this is the Raiders, and the team is still in London following Sunday's shellacking. Allen hasn't done anything to suggest he's the man to lead the Raiders out of the mire, but anyone who's followed the situation knows GM Reggie McKenzie's persistently disastrous personnel decisions are the real problem in Oakland. Allen would be a textbook scapegoat for his boss' failings. The Raiders have been the worst-run team in football for over a decade, and there's no light at the end of the tunnel.
